The original celadon appeared in the early Shang period and prevailed in the Spring and Autumn Period and the Warring States Period. Before the Warring States Period, due to the low level of technology at that time, the raw material treatment was not finely filtered, washed, pinched, aged and grinded, and other processes, the shape of the utensils was simple, the carcass had many cracks, and the glaze was very unstable.
In the Warring States Period, the production of primitive porcelain has made great progress, its sintering surname can and the surface glaze and other aspects have been greatly developed, the shape of the vessel is regular, the thickness of the glaze layer is uniform, the glaze color is green and yellow, the shape is more like the bronze ware at that time, there are respect, ding, gui, 盉, beans, bells, etc., the ornamentation is mostly decorated with carving, scratching, pinching and molding, etc., with a simple and concise style.

In today's auction market, ceramics, bronze and calligraphy and painting have always shown a three-legged trend, and for ceramics, it is the official kiln, the private kiln and the ancient porcelain.
As early as ten years ago, an auction house in Hong Kong had launched a Qing Qianlong style of gold pastel hollow hexagonal set of bottles that had been looted by the British and French forces, and after dozens of rounds of fierce competition, it was finally sold for 20.95 million Hong Kong dollars.
In the second year, the porcelain of the Ming and Qing dynasties shined in the market. A piece of Qianlong Pink Flower Butterfly Pattern Ruyi Erzun of the Qing Dynasty was sold at an auction in Hong Kong for 33.045 million Hong Kong dollars, which once set a new record for China's official kiln porcelain, and surprised the world. The high-end market is frequent, and the blue and white and pastel of the three generations of the Qing Dynasty also have a good performance in the market. Among the top 100 porcelain transactions, the Qing dynasty accounted for 61 pieces.
In addition to the three dynasties of the Qing Dynasty, the official kilns of each dynasty are highly sought after, especially those big collectors, big entrepreneurs, especially loved, all have a strong collection of things that the emperor plays**.
As for the folk kiln, just as the clothes are divided into famous brands and ordinary goods, the ceramic market is also divided into high, medium and low-grade, and the boutique official kilns in the high-end market are often millions of millions, and the general public can only look up and point at it.
However, the folk kiln ware has been appreciated by the middle and low-end investment consumer groups for its low price, large number of survival, diverse modeling styles and huge appreciation space, and the stock of the folk kiln is larger than that of the official kiln.
Finally, there is Gaogu porcelain, the so-called Gaogu porcelain, refers to the porcelain unearthed before the Yuan Dynasty, which naturally includes the original celadon.
In fact, the porcelain of the late Qing Dynasty and the Republic of China can be regarded as a collection of unpopular ones, and their prices are not high, but once there are fine products available, they can be sold at a good price.
However, most of the original celadon in the market reaction is relatively cold, there are many reasons, especially its identification is very difficult, it is not like the Ming and Qing Dynasty official kilns in general shape, glaze, ornamental development of the flow of order, often appear some never seen unique products, which brings difficulty to the identification.
